Kristin Wells M.S., CCC-SLP, is a speech language pathologist currently working for the Jackson County EI/ECSE program at the Douglas ESD in Medford, Oregon. She currently services children ages 3-5 by providing speech and language therapy in speech groups, community preschool classrooms, and consultation with teachers and families. Kristin has previous experience teaching as a general education teacher in the K-12 setting.
More Support, Less Burnout: Dedicated Service Coordinators in Oregon EI/ECSE
Across Oregon ECSE programs, expectations keep growing—while resources stay the same. Discover how Jackson County EI/ECSE strategically reassigned teacher roles to serve as dedicated Service Coordinators, enhancing family partnerships, easing therapist caseload pressures, and fostering sustainable work–life balance for staff.
Objectives:
1. Understand the current landscape of ECSE services in Oregon and Jackson County EI/ECSE’s response to it.
2. Identify how dedicated Service Coordinators benefited therapists’ workload, job satisfaction & improved services to families.
3. Learn how to advocate for dedicated Service Coordinators in your program!
